Output 884a29edcb21374b67cca1327ccee235840379c32633cd102432f652c786bbf3:0

value
676810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9328f66589448ac8af71213cb0eb02a0bccd095 OP_EQUAL
address
3Nx3wDo8nCKdc7N5CruRNz5DyaDsKdB9J1
transaction
884a29edcb21374b67cca1327ccee235840379c32633cd102432f652c786bbf3
spent
true